Output 8aeb51bbd8015a78a34bb146b422ea2eb3a6dfd75daef37f86fefbefdc10505c:1

value
660605
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4aaf6bacc3d5bfb3f4106dabb32ffa0e3b10ae2c5544d7c001e09077123eab5e
address
bc1pf2hkhtxr6klm8aqsdk4mxtl6pca3pt3v24zd0sqpuzg8wy374d0q3lquwj
transaction
8aeb51bbd8015a78a34bb146b422ea2eb3a6dfd75daef37f86fefbefdc10505c
spent
true